Rina Cartson on MSN
Red makeup look that accidentally gives Terminator vibes
Discover a red makeup look that accidentally gives off strong Terminator vibes. The mass media’s blind spot on Trump’s Venezuela escalation Where Lake Mead water levels stand amid heavy California 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results